10 Must Have Websites for a Front-end Web Developer

The tech industry is dynamic, and every web developer needs to familiarize themselves with the latest tools and resources to succeed. Front-end web development is fast-paced and aims to provide users with the ideal visual experience. For any front-end web developer to solve real-time problems, they need to liaise with other developers, acquire relevant skills, and constantly gain designing skills on tools and techniques.

Besides, the landing page and all the functionalities on the front-end module should contain readable information. Front-end developers should also consider compatibility with the large plethora of devices with varying resolutions and varying screen sizes. Here are some of the top websites that front-end developers can use to learn about various design practices.

Top Websites for Every Front-End Web Developer

front-end web developer
front-end web developer

1. MDN Web Docs

Every front-end web developer can use the resource to get answers on the ideal web development practices and patterns. It’s a comprehensive reference that covers various web development languages, including CSS, HTML, JavaScript, and more. In addition, the resource offers web developers documentation and tutorials. It’s a community-driven platform that provides front-end developers with relevant information at all levels of expertise. MDN Web Docs provides high-quality and up-to-date information on web development.

2. Stack Overflow

Being a renowned programming and web development site, web developers can get relevant information from the site. Developers get clarity on various answers regarding web development. Moreover, the question-answer platform is designed to find solutions to specific programming problems while developing websites and web-based applications. Besides providing answers to technical web development questions, Stack Overflow features a collection of code spinners with examples. However, the information may not be up-to-date, and developers need to verify the solutions while implementing their projects.

Ignite Your Tech Future with The Ultimate Coding Training Package

3. CSS-Tricks

It’s a blog and resource site on front-end development and CSS. Developers can get tutorials, articles, code snippets, and examples covering basic to advanced design techniques. Developers can get insight into different topics, including user interface design, cross-browser compatibility, responsive design, and more. In addition, the site provides developers with multifold aspects of web design and development, especially on HTML and JavaScript accessibility. The resource enables developers to improve their CSS skills with the latest techniques and find creative solutions for design.

4. W3Schools

W3School is also a viable site for beginners since it has tutorials and examples that are precise and easy to execute. It’s an online learning platform for web development technologies like CSS, JavaScript, and HTML. It’s recommendable for beginners due to the clear and concise introduction to the basics of web development. In addition, it’s optimized and simplified to enable developers to read and understand the development skills step-by-step.

Other related posts:

Ignite Your Tech Future with The Ultimate Coding Training Package

5. JavaSript.info

This site provides a comprehensive guide to developers on JavaScript programming. It is suitable for beginner and experienced developers. It has lessons and tutorials on basic and the latest features of JavaScript. JavaScript.info provides clear and practical explanations of JavaScript concepts and techniques. As a result, the platform is suitable for developers willing to improve their JavaScript skills for creating dynamic and interactive web experiences. It also enables front-end developers to write efficient and maintainable codes that are user-friendly.

6. Can I Use

This website allows web developers check whether their browser supports HTML, CSS, and JavaScript. It’s a must-have resource for any front-end web developer looking to ensure the code is executable on all devices and browsers. It’s neither a tool nor technology but a website that offers a reference for front-end developers. It’s viable for determining any fallbacks or polyfills on browsers targeted by front-end developers.

7. Codecademy

It’s an interactive learning platform for coding and web development. It allows developers to get started or expand their skills in various web-based programming languages, including CSS, JavaScript, HTML, and more. The online platform offers courses and projects for developers to enable them to create dynamic and interactive coding projects. It also provides learners a platform to exercise their knowledge by gaining practical experience. In addition, it provides a supportive community of beginners on their project’s progress.

8. FreeCodeCamp

This is a non-profit platform that offers developers a full curriculum in web design and development. The resource is ideal for novice programmers since it has various courses that cover basic to advanced topics. It covers JavaScript, HTML, CSS, and more. Moreover, the platform offers a hands-on learning approach via interactive coding exercises and projects. In addition, it provides a platform for learners and instructors and various tools and resources for front-end development.

9. GitHub

GitHub is a popular web-based hosting service for software development, version control, and collaboration. It’s a useful tool that allows various front-end developers to collaborate on projects, code execution, and tracking of any changes. Developers can share code and manage their web project CSS, HTML, and JavaScript files. To ensure the project works seamlessly, GitHub also provides other features, including pull requests, issue tracking, and code reviews. In addition, it has a large repository of open-source projects and libraries that are ideal for front-end developers willing to reuse codes for their projects.

10. CodePen

CodePen is a social development platform for every front-end web developer. It has real-time collaboration features and a library of code snippets with examples. It also allows front-end developers to link up and work on their projects. As a result, developers can write and share HTML, CSS, and JavaScript code snippets and real-time code execution. The programming tool is also used for testing, experimenting, and displaying front-end code.

It also showcases a live preview of the written code, allowing a front-end web developer to see the outcomes and make relevant changes. CodePen also allows developers to comment on each other’s projects, especially for learning. Some of the features of the valuable programming resource include add-ons, preprocessors, and libraries that streamline front-end development workflows and projects.

Ignite Your Tech Future with The Ultimate Coding Training Package

Frequently Asked Questions

What are must-have websites for every front-end web developer?

Must-have websites for every front-end web developer include resources for learning and improving front-end development skills, documentation for popular front-end frameworks and libraries, code editors and other development tools, and online communities for connecting with other developers and getting support.

Why are these websites considered must-haves for front-end web developers?

These websites are considered must-haves for front-end web developers because they provide essential resources and tools for learning, improving, and staying up-to-date with front-end development. By using these websites, developers can enhance their skills, streamline their workflow, and access a community of peers who can offer guidance and support.

Can beginner front-end developers use these websites?

Absolutely. These websites are useful for developers at all levels, including beginners just starting out with front-end development. Many of these websites offer tutorials, documentation, and other resources that are specifically geared toward beginners, making it easier for them to learn and improve their skills.

Are these websites free to use?

Many of these websites are free to use, although some may offer premium services or content for a fee. However, the core resources and tools that front-end developers need are typically available for free.

What is required for front end web developer?

To become a front-end web developer, you will need to have a solid understanding of HTML, CSS, and JavaScript. These are the core technologies used to create the user interface and visual design of websites and web applications.

Here are some specific skills and knowledge areas that are typically required for front-end web development:

  1. HTML: Knowledge of the markup language used to structure content on web pages.
  2. CSS: Knowledge of the stylesheet language used to add visual styling to web pages.
  3. JavaScript: Knowledge of the programming language used to add interactive and dynamic features to web pages.
  4. Responsive design: Ability to create web pages that work well on various devices and screen sizes.
  5. Cross-browser compatibility: Ability to create web pages that work consistently across different web browsers.
  6. Version control: Understanding of version control systems like Git to track changes and collaborate with other developers.
  7. Design tools: Familiarity with design tools like Sketch, Figma, or Adobe XD to create and collaborate on design mockups.
  8. Web performance optimization: Knowledge of techniques to optimize website performance, such as minimizing file sizes and reducing page load times.
  9. Accessibility: Understanding of accessibility standards and how to create web pages that are accessible to all users, including those with disabilities.
  10. Frameworks and libraries: Familiarity with front-end frameworks and libraries like React, Angular, or Vue.js, which can speed up development and simplify coding.

Do front end developers build websites?

Yes, front-end developers build websites by using programming languages such as HTML, CSS, and JavaScript to create the visual and interactive elements of a website that users see and interact with. They work on the client-side of the website, meaning they focus on what the end user sees and experiences when they visit a website.

Front-end developers are responsible for building website layouts, designing the user interface, creating navigation menus, and implementing other interactive elements like forms, animations, and other features that make a website more engaging and user-friendly. They also need to ensure that the website is responsive and works well on different devices, such as desktop computers, tablets, and smartphones.

Wrapping Up

Websites showcasing front-end capabilities, tools, resources, and features are endless, and gaining skills as a developer is easy. Front-end development is easily achievable with the right tools and resources. As a result, every front-end web developer should take up the challenge and delve into redefining web design skills. Based on the demand by many firms to scale up their business, front-end developers need to expand their skills. In addition, scrutinizing user experience and utilizing the ideal tools and resources is the bookmark of web development.

Ignite Your Tech Future with The Ultimate Coding Training Package

Resources

Why you should hire a frontend developer

Frontend developer

Author

Dennis M
Dennis M

Hi, I'm Dennis, a software developer and blogger who specializes in programming languages and compilers. My blog posts focus on software development and programming topics like HTML5, CSS3, JavaScript frameworks like AngularJS and ReactJS as well as PHP-based applications. Check and join my group to ensure that you do not miss any of my informative articles on this field: https://www.facebook.com/groups/softwaredevelopmentinsights

Articles: 201